Stefano Pioli has named his beginning XI for this evening's conflict between AC Milan and Torino at San Siro.

After the success in the opener, the director has chosen to roll out no improvements to the eleven.

The Rossoneri began the season in the most effective way conceivable, scoring two objectives and keeping a spotless sheet. 

Presently back at San Siro, they will be hoping to repeat the exhibition before a sold-out swarm (72k present, among them Gerry Cardinale).

Pioli has chosen to depend on the starters we have found lately, meaning Christian Pulisic keeps his spot on the right flank.

Olivier Giroud was addressed during pre-season yet he did all around well against Bologna, solidifying his spot.

Official Milan XI (4-3-3): Maignan; Calabria, Thiaw, Tomori, Theo Hernandez; Loftus-Cheek, Krunic, Reijnders; Pulisic, Giroud, Leao.

Subs: Mirante, Sportiello; Florenzi, Kalulu, Kjær, Pellegrino; Adli, Musah, Pobega, Romero; Chukwueze, Okafor, Colombo.
